Anchovy Art Gallery Exploration
Steeped in Santoña’s maritime essence, the Anchovy Art Gallery beckons visitors to embark on a sensory journey through the intricate world of anchovy processing and preservation. The gallery showcases the cultural significance of anchovy art, offering a glimpse into the traditional methods of filleting and preserving these prized fish. Visitors can marvel at antique machinery at the Conservas Ana María Gallery, gaining a deeper understanding of the historical importance of anchovies in the region.
Through interactive displays and informative guides, guests can enjoy the craftsmanship and artistry behind anchovy production. This experience not only educates on the technical aspects but also highlights the deep-rooted connection between anchovies and the cultural heritage of Santoña.

How Are the Anchovies Caught and Sourced for Processing at the Gallery?
Anchovies for processing at the gallery are sourced sustainably through traditional fishing techniques. Local fishermen use purse seining, ensuring minimal bycatch and supporting marine conservation. Sustainability initiatives are paramount in preserving the anchovy population.
